What can I do in Woodland?
Wasatch-Cache National Forest and Provo River are a few of the interesting sights to visit. Additional attractions in the area include Jordanelle Reservoir and Utah Valley University - Wasatch Campus.
What's the seasonal weather like in Woodland?
The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 61°F, while the coldest months are December and January with an average of 22°F. The snowiest months in Woodland are January, February, December, and March, with each month seeing an average of 18 inches of snowfall.
What's the best way to get to and around Woodland?
Fly into Salt Lake City International Airport (SLC), which is located 41.6 mi (67 km) away from the heart of the city. If you’d like to venture out around the area,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
